UV printing, also known as ultraviolet printing, is a cutting - edge printing technology that has transformed the printing industry. Unlike traditional printing methods, UV printing uses ultraviolet light to cure or dry the ink almost instantly. This is achieved by exposing the printed ink to UV light, which causes the ink to harden and bond to the printing surface.
The process of UV printing starts with the design. Once the design is finalized, it is sent to the UV printer. The printer then sprays a special UV - curable ink onto the substrate. This substrate can be a wide range of materials, including glass, metal, plastic, wood, and even fabric.
After the ink is applied, the printed area passes under a UV lamp. The UV light triggers a chemical reaction in the ink, causing it to polymerize and solidify. This rapid curing process is what sets UV printing apart from other methods. For example, in a signage production company, they can print high - quality, detailed graphics on acrylic sheets. The instant curing means that the signs can be handled and installed right away, reducing production time significantly.
One of the most significant advantages of UV printing is its versatility. It can be used on almost any surface, regardless of its texture or shape. This makes it ideal for a variety of applications, from custom - printed phone cases to large - scale billboards.
Another advantage is the durability of the printed results. Since the ink is cured and bonded to the surface, it is resistant to scratching, fading, and wear. For instance, a furniture manufacturer can use UV printing to add intricate designs to wooden furniture. The printed patterns will remain vibrant and intact even after years of use.
UV printing also offers high - resolution and accurate color reproduction. Printers can achieve sharp details and vivid colors, making it perfect for applications where visual appeal is crucial. In the art reproduction industry, UV printing can faithfully replicate the colors and details of original paintings, providing art lovers with high - quality copies.
Moreover, UV printing is an environmentally friendly option. The UV - curable inks do not contain volatile organic compounds (VOCs), which are harmful to the environment and human health. This makes it a more sustainable choice compared to some traditional printing methods.
